1. How Christmas Candles Help Relieve Stress
The holiday season can be both joyous and stressful, with packed schedules, shopping lists, and social gatherings. Christmas candles offer a simple yet effective way to unwind and regain a sense of calm amidst the chaos. Their warm glow and soothing fragrances create a peaceful ambiance that helps melt away stress.
When you light a Christmas candle, the combination of flickering light and carefully crafted scents activates the brain’s relaxation response. Scents like pine, cinnamon, and vanilla are known to evoke feelings of comfort and nostalgia, reducing anxiety and promoting a sense of well-being.
2. Top Calming Christmas Scents for Stress Relief
The right fragrance can make all the difference when it comes to stress relief. Here are some popular Christmas candle scents that are perfect for relaxation:
- Pine and Fir: These earthy, forest-inspired scents bring the outdoors inside, offering a grounding and calming effect.
- Lavender and Chamomile: Known for their stress-reducing properties, these scents are perfect for quiet evenings at home.
- Cinnamon and Clove: Warm and spicy, these holiday classics create a cozy atmosphere that soothes the senses.
- Vanilla and Amber: Sweet and smooth, these scents promote relaxation and a sense of comfort.
- Eucalyptus and Peppermint: Refreshing yet calming, these scents clear the mind and enhance focus while reducing stress.
Choose a scent that resonates with you to maximize the stress-relieving benefits of your Christmas candles.
3. Creating a Relaxing Holiday Atmosphere
Christmas candles are more than just decorations—they’re tools to help you create a serene environment. Here are some tips to enhance their impact:
- Use Multiple Candles: Place candles throughout your home to create a consistent and calming ambiance.
- Pair with Music: Soft holiday music or instrumental tunes complement the soothing effects of candlelight and fragrance.
- Incorporate Nature: Decorate with pinecones, holly, or garlands to amplify the natural feel of Christmas scents like pine and fir.
- Designate a Relaxation Space: Set up a cozy corner with a comfortable chair, a blanket, and a few candles to create your personal stress-free zone.
With these small adjustments, you can turn your home into a haven of peace and tranquility during the holidays.
